The LEGO Hufflepuff House Banner (76412) is a compact build that doesn't waste a piece, clocking in at 313 pieces. Released in 2023 as part of the Harry Potter House Banners collection, it retails for $34.99. You get 3 minifigures in the box, which adds to the collectible appeal.
The price-per-piece works out to $0.112, which is solid for what you're getting.
